What You’ll Need

Developing mobile applications for both iOS and Android requires certain tools and resources. To build an app, you’ll need the development environment, a language to code in, and various other tools and libraries.

  • For iOS apps, you’ll need an Apple device, such as an iPhone or iPad, and Apple’s Xcode development environment.
  • Xcode uses the programming language Swift to create apps for iPhones, iPads, and Macs. However, if your app needs to support older versions of iOS, then Objective-C is still necessary.
  • For developing Android apps, you’ll need an Android device and Google’s Android Studio package, which contains the Android SDK (Software Development Kit).
  • Android Studio uses Java to develop apps for any Android device. Additionally, developers may use Kotlin, an open source programming language.
  • Other frameworks, such as React Native and Ionic, may also be used to develop both iOS and Android apps simultaneously.

iOS Development

Developing apps for iOS devices requires a good understanding of programming languages, frameworks and tools. The two main languages used for iOS development are Objective-C and Swift. Objective-C is an object-oriented language that has been around for several decades, while Swift is a more recent language, released in 2014. Each language has its own strengths and drawbacks, so it’s important to take the time to weigh your options before you start developing your app.

In addition to the programming language of choice, there are several frameworks and tools available to help with iOS development. These include Apple’s Xcode IDE, Cocoa Touch, and Appcelerator. It’s important to take the time to familiarize yourself with these tools and decide which are best suited for your project.

Of course, when it comes to creating apps for iOS devices, design considerations are also important. Apple provides developers with a number of design guidelines that must be followed when creating an app. These include specific rules for layout, fonts, and other UI elements. Additionally, iOS devices come in many different sizes and resolutions, so it’s important to make sure your app looks great on all of them.

Android Development

Android development is an essential part of creating mobile apps for both iOS and Android. The most popular language for developing Android applications is Java, and the official integrated development environment (IDE) that Google recommends is Android Studio. Android Studio is a free and open-source IDE, and is based on the IntelliJ IDEA platform.

In addition to Android Studio, there are several third-party IDEs available for Android developers such as Eclipse and Visual Studio. All three of these development tools allow developers to write code, debug, and package Android apps. Other useful tools available for Android development include libraries such as Google Play Services and Google Mobile Ads SDK, the Android SDK Build-Tools, and the Android Studio Emulator.

Developers should also consider design constraints when creating apps for Android devices, since different platforms often require different solutions. Designing for Android should account for screen sizes, device orientations, hardware features, and more. Knowing the different design elements, as well as the different development tools, will help developers create better experiences for their users.

Best Practices for Mobile App Development

Developing mobile apps for both iOS and Android can be quite challenging, and it’s important to keep certain best practices in mind if you want to create successful applications. Here are some tips and tricks that will help you get the most out of your mobile app development.

  • Planning: Before you start coding, it’s important to create a detailed plan that outlines the features of the app, the target audience, and the overall user experience.
  • Testing: Test your app thoroughly before launch, both on physical devices and emulators. Test on different versions of the operating system to ensure that your app works properly across multiple versions.
  • Performance: Performance is key when it comes to mobile apps. Make sure that your app functions quickly and efficiently by using effective coding techniques and optimizing assets.
  • User Interface (UI): Pay attention to the user interface to ensure that your app is attractive and easy to use. Use appropriate colors and fonts, and minimize the number of steps needed to complete tasks.
  • Marketing: After completing your app, make sure to promote it effectively. Utilize different social media channels and online ad networks to reach your target audience.

By following these best practices, you can develop successful mobile apps for both iOS and Android with ease.

Getting Started with iOS and Android Development

Developing mobile applications for iOS and Android can be intimidating, but once you understand the basics, it’s an exciting and rewarding journey. Here’s how to get started:

  • Choose a Platform: Before you start coding, you’ll need to decide what platform you’re going to develop your app for. Do your research and decide which platform is best for you.
  • Download the SDK: Next, you’ll need to download the Software Development Kit (SDK) for the platform you plan to develop for. For iOS apps, you’ll need Xcode; for Android apps, you’ll need Android Studio.
  • Study the Language: While you don’t need to be an expert in the programming language of your chosen platform, it’s important to have a basic understanding of the language. For iOS, this means learning Objective-C or Swift; for Android apps, this means learning Java.
  • Use the Available Tools: To create more complex functions and features for your app, take advantage of the tools offered by the platform. For iOS, this could mean using frameworks like Cocoa Touch, UIKit, and CoreMotion; for Android, this could mean using libraries like Android Support Library and Material Design.
  • Design With Intention: When designing a mobile application, be sure to consider the unique constraints posed by each platform. This includes taking into account each platform’s user interface guidelines, device sizes, and hardware specs.
  • Test and Debug: Before you submit your app to the app store, make sure to thoroughly test it in order to catch any bugs or errors. Use emulators or physical devices to simulate real-world usage of your app.
  • Submit your App: After you’ve completed all the steps above, you’re finally ready to submit your application to the appropriate app stores for approval.
